Byzantine medicine remains a little known and misrepresented field not only in the context of debates on medieval medicine, but also among byzantinists themselves. It is often viewed as 'stagnant' and mainly preserving ancient ideas, and our knowledge of it continues to be based to a great extent on the comments of earlier authorities, which are often repeated uncritically.

The byzantine period saw a massive rise in the production of medical encyclopedias. The language of these texts was mainly learned byzantine greek; the vernacular was rarely used. Overall, there was a certain tendency toward the practical application of medicine rather than a development of new models.

Scholars have made conflicting claims for byzantine hospitals as medical institutions and as the forebears of the modern hospital. In this study is the first systematic examination of the evidence of the xenon texts, or xenonika, on which all such claims must in part rest.
